在Web开发的世界里,表单是用户与网站交互的重要桥梁。对于新手开发者来说,选择合适的Web表单开发框架至关重要。本文将深入评测5款热门的Web表单开发框架,并提供实战技巧,帮助你快速上手。
1. Bootstrap
简介
Bootstrap是一款流行的前端框架,它提供了丰富的组件和工具,可以帮助开发者快速构建响应式布局的Web表单。
评测
- 优点:易于上手,组件丰富,支持响应式设计。
- 缺点:样式较为固定,自定义性相对较低。
实战技巧
- 使用Bootstrap的表单控件,如
form-group、form-control等,可以快速创建美观的表单。 - 利用Bootstrap的栅格系统,实现表单的响应式布局。
2. jQuery UI
简介
jQuery UI是基于jQuery的一个用户界面库,提供了丰富的UI组件和交互效果,包括表单控件。
评测
- 优点:与jQuery无缝集成,组件丰富,交互效果强大。
- 缺点:学习曲线较陡峭,性能可能不如原生JavaScript。
实战技巧
- 使用jQuery UI的表单控件,如
autocomplete、datepicker等,可以增强用户体验。 - 利用jQuery UI的动画和过渡效果,使表单交互更加生动。
3. Materialize CSS
简介
Materialize CSS是一个响应式的前端框架,它基于Google的Material Design设计规范,提供了丰富的组件和工具。
评测
- 优点:设计风格现代,组件丰富,易于上手。
- 缺点:文档相对较少,自定义性有限。
实战技巧
- 使用Materialize CSS的表单控件,如
input-field、select等,可以快速创建美观的表单。 - 利用Materialize CSS的动画和过渡效果,提升用户体验。
4. Semantic UI
简介
Semantic UI是一个简单、直观、响应式的前端框架,它提供了丰富的组件和工具,可以帮助开发者快速构建高质量的UI。
评测
- 优点:组件丰富,易于上手,文档齐全。
- 缺点:性能可能不如原生JavaScript。
实战技巧
- 使用Semantic UI的表单控件,如
form、input等,可以快速创建美观的表单。 - 利用Semantic UI的栅格系统,实现表单的响应式布局。
5. Foundation
简介
Foundation是一个响应式的前端框架,它提供了丰富的组件和工具,可以帮助开发者快速构建高质量的UI。
评测
- 优点:组件丰富,易于上手,文档齐全。
- 缺点:性能可能不如原生JavaScript。
实战技巧
- 使用Foundation的表单控件,如
form、input等,可以快速创建美观的表单。 - 利用Foundation的栅格系统,实现表单的响应式布局。
总结
选择适合自己的Web表单开发框架,可以帮助你提高开发效率,提升用户体验。以上5款热门的Web表单开发框架各有特点,新手开发者可以根据自己的需求和喜好进行选择。同时,掌握实战技巧,可以帮助你更快地上手并熟练运用这些框架。
